Dr. Richard Land, one of the most prominent Christians in America, is the executive editor of The Christian Post. He was also the longtime president of the Southern Baptist Convention’s Ethics & Religious Liberty Commission — and knows the denomination well.

Now, he’s speaking out about the SBC’s bombshell abuse report and answering one of the most challenging questions of the moment: Where does the SBC go from here?
